What to expect at Cheese Museum Paris?
1/5
Discover French cheese culture
The Living Cheese Museum in Paris takes you on a journey through centuries of tradition, from how monks aged their wheels in medieval cellars to how modern artisans preserve regional methods today.
Witness live cheesemaking in action
Through glass panels, you can watch live demonstrations of how milk is transformed into fresh cheese, step by step. From curdling to molding, it’s a fascinating look into the process that makes every slice and wheel possible.
Explore a historic cheese cellar
Descend into a real 17th-century aging cellar and learn how temperature, humidity, and time shape a cheese’s final texture and flavor. It’s cool, quiet, and filled with wheels in various stages of aging, a true behind-the-scenes peek into this critical part of the craft.
Taste classic regional cheeses
Led by a passionate expert, you’ll sample four different French cheeses, each chosen to highlight a different region or style, from soft and creamy to firm and nutty. It’s a guided sensory experience that brings everything you’ve learned during the visit to life.
Learn to make cheese yourself
You'll experience the full process of crafting fresh cheese from start to finish. You’ll stir, mold, and shape it yourself while learning the science and stories behind every step. This offers a fun and interactive chance to connect with one of France’s most iconic food traditions.
Things to know before booking your Cheese Museum tickets
Which experience should you choose?
With the Guided Tour with Tastings ticket, you’ll have access to the Living Cheese Museum, along with a curated tasting of four traditional French cheeses. A cheese expert will walk you through the exhibits and share how cheese is made, aged, and enjoyed across France. Tours are available in English or French.
The Cheesemaking Workshop with Tastings takes place at Paris’s only Cheese School, a separate location from the museum. You’ll learn how to make fresh cheese from start to finish and enjoy a tasting at the end. This ticket does not include entry to the Living Cheese Museum. If you’d like to visit the museum as well, the tickets need to be booked separately. This experience is offered only in English.
The Art of Pairing Cheese and Wine ticket includes a guided tasting held in the cellar located beneath the museum. You’ll sample a curated selection of French cheeses and wines, with insights into how they complement each other. The session is offered in English or French. Please note that this ticket does not include access to the Cheese Museum, and if you’d like to visit the exhibits, a separate museum ticket is required.
Museum entry is included only in the Guided Tour ticket. The workshop and cheese pairing sessions happen at separate locations.
When to book?
To get your preferred time slot, especially for workshops and cheese pairing sessions, it’s best to book 1–2 weeks in advance. This is especially important during the summer season (June-August), weekends, holidays, and school breaks when spots fill up quickly.
Cheese Museum Paris highlights
French cheese map
Start your visit with a visual feast, a giant illustrated map showcasing the origins of France’s most iconic cheeses. From Normandy’s Camembert to Auvergne’s Bleu, trace the country’s diverse terroirs and learn what makes each region’s cheese unique.
Cheese tasting cave
Head down into the museum’s vaulted stone cellar for a guided tasting in an authentic setting. Surrounded by aging wheels and the aroma of affinage, you’ll sample a curated lineup of French cheeses, soft, hard, mild, and bold, served with optional wine pairings.
Magic wall of cheesemaking
This interactive digital wall brings the cheesemaking process to life in a playful, hands-on way. Touchscreens use animation and fun facts to guide you through each step, from milk to mold. It is a favorite with kids and adults alike, making complex techniques easy to grasp and memorable.
Plan your visit to Cheese Museum Paris
Open daily from 10am to 7:30pm
Closed on Sundays
Visit duration: 1 to 1.5 hours
Workshop duration: 2 hours
Cheese pairing session: 2 hours 15 minutes
Cheese Museum Paris (Guided tour and cheese pairing sessions happen here)
Address: 39 Rue Saint-Louis en l'Île, 75004 Paris
Metro:
Line 7 - Pont Marie (Cité des Arts)
Line 1 - Saint-Paul (Le Marais)
Both stations are less than a 10-minute walk from the museum.
Bus:
Line 67 - Île Saint-Louis
Lines 67, 86, 87 - Pont Sully (Quai de Béthune)
Paroles de Fromagers - The Cheese School of Paris (Cheesemaking workshop happens here)
Address: 41 Rue du Faubourg du Temple 75010 Paris
Metro:
Line 11 - Goncourt
Wheelchair & stroller friendly (only the museum, not the cellar)
Washrooms
Gift shop
Photography is allowed, but flash and tripods are not permitted.
Outside food and drinks are not allowed.
Only certified service animals are allowed inside the museum.
